Azure DevOps Developer 

PURPOSE 

We are looking for an Azure DevOps Developer who will play a pivotal role in the complex process of transitioning from legacy on-premises infrastructure to cloud-based solutions on the Azure platform. This role requires a strong background in cloud computing and automation. The candidate will be responsible for designing, implementing, and maintaining the client's cloud infrastructure while managing Continuous Integration/Continuous Deployment (CI/CD) pipelines. The developer will work closely with multiple implementation teams and ensure that code changes are made swiftly, safely, and efficiently across all environments. All team members will regularly interact with stakeholders to ensure seamless migration and ongoing support. The role offers remote work opportunities with occasional in-person meetings as needed. 

RESPONSIBILITIES 

  • Provision and manage infrastructure resources in the cloud using tools like Terraform. 
  • Establish and manage CI/CD pipelines to automate the build, test, and deployment processes and that code changes are made swiftly and safely. 
  • Provide technical expertise and guidance to multiple implementation teams involved in the migration process, ensuring alignment with project timelines and deliverables. 
  • Conduct regular stakeholder training and status updates to communicate project milestones, risks, and dependencies, and address any concerns or feedback. 
  • Create Azure Boards and Azure Test Plans for Quality Assurance. 
  • Ensure that the cloud infrastructure is secure and compliant with industry standards and proactively identify and mitigate potential risks. 
  • Create documentation for migrated systems, processes, and configurations, to ensure clarity and consistency across project teams 
  • Other Responsibilities as assigned by management 

MINIMUM SKILLS, EDUCATION, AND EXPERIENCE 

  • Strong knowledge of Azure DevOps tools and services, including Azure Boards, Azure Repos, Azure Pipelines, Azure Test Plans, and Azure Artifacts. 
  • 3+ years of a client facing role with demonstrated proficiency in relationship building and effective communication. 
  • 3+ years of experience in software development, cloud computing, or a related field. 
  • Experience with Infrastructure as Code (IaC) tools like Terraform. 
  • Experience with CI/CD tools like Jenkins or TeamCity. 
  • Strong scripting skills in PowerShell, Bash, or Python. 
  • Experienced in Microsoft 365 tools. 

PREFERRED SKILLS, EDUCATION, AND EXPERIENCE 

  • Azure certifications preferred 
  • DevSecOps experience preferred

What you need to know about the Chicago Tech Scene

With vibrant neighborhoods, great food and more affordable housing than either coast, Chicago might be the most liveable major tech hub. It is the birthplace of modern commodities and futures trading, a national hub for logistics and commerce, and home to the American Medical Association and the American Bar Association. This diverse blend of industry influences has helped Chicago emerge as a major player in verticals like fintech, biotechnology, legal tech, e-commerce and logistics technology. It’s also a major hiring center for tech companies on both coasts.

Key Facts About Chicago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 245,800; 5.2%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: McDonald’s, John Deere, Boeing, Morningstar
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, fintech, software, logistics technology
  • Funding Landscape: $2.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Pritzker Group Venture Capital, Arch Venture Partners, MATH Venture Partners, Jump Capital, Hyde Park Venture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: Northwestern University, University of Chicago, University of Illinois Urbana-Champaign, Illinois Institute of Technology, Argonne National Laboratory, Fermi National Accelerator Laboratory
